Presiding Bishop to address congregational leaders in the Minneapolis Area and Saint Paul Area Synods
On Oct.15, you are invited to join Presiding Bishop Mark Hanson at Luther Seminary in St. Paul for Fueling our Missional Fire. Hanson will speak on the mission of the Evangelical Lutheran Church in America (ELCA)--what we do, why it is important, and how deeply we reach into communities in this country and around the globe. Lay and clergy leaders and congregational members are invited to attend.
This event kicks off the synod's Fall Stewardship Series. (Fanning the Flames of Mission will be held Oct. 27 at Roseville Lutheran, Roseville.) In addition, the 16 congregations who made up the pilot group of the Macedonia Project will be celebrating its completion at this event.

Webinar by Portico Benefits Services, "The Supreme Court Decision and ELCA Health Coverage"
Jul. 10, 11:00-11:30 a.m. As media coverage swirls following today's Supreme Court decision, you're probably wondering: "How will all this affect me?" In this 30-minute webinar, Brad Joern, VP of Products and Services at Portico Benefit Services, and David Delahanty, consultant from Towers Watson, will go beyond the headlines and discuss the changes for anyone who has, or provides, ELCA health benefits. Summer office schedule
For six weeks each summer, the synod office closes at noon on Fridays. The summer schedule started on Jul. 6 and will run through Aug.10. In addition, staff sabbaticals and transitions this summer mean that some days the office is thinly staffed. Please check in before you stop by, and be mindful of the construction on University Ave.
